Abstract :
Despite the potential advantages of the Java technology, very few experiments have been made so far on trying to provide an in depth integration of this technology with the TMN framework. To foster the experimentation of these advantages, we present a generic and free Java API developed for both OSI CMIS Manager and Agent sides. The main objective of this API is provide a solid basis for researchers and developers in order to allow large OSI as well as integration environment developments to take advantage of the Java technology combined with the OSI framework
